> 	I'd better grab this one, OsiDylp is my responsibility. I'm aware of the
> problem but don't have access to a 64-bit system to do testing.
>
> 	The warnings should not be significant.
> 	
> 	The error messages (there are several occurrences) are due to a set of
> informational messages. You should be able to get them to go away by redoing
> the configure with --without-osidylp-info, or by editing the file 
> Osi/inc/config_osi.h. Simply comment out the line
>
> #define ODSI_INFOMSGS 1
>
> or replace it with
>
> #undef ODSI_INFOMSGS
>
> You'll see the pattern in config_osi.h. Autoconf goes one step further, putting
> comments around the undef to avoid possible symbol conflicts.
>
> If you're willing, could you please try the following?
> Each occurence of the problem will look something like this:
>
> #   ifdef ODSI_INFOMSGS
>     hdl->message(ODSI_ATTACH,messages_)
>       << "resolve" << reinterpret_cast<int>(this)
>       << CoinMessageEol ;
> #   endif
>
> The problem is the reinterpret_cast --- it needs to be something large enough
> to hold an address. I'm guessing that int is 32 bits and addresses are now 64 
> bits. Replacing `int' with `long int' might fix the problem.
>
>   
I tried this but it didn't work. I  will look up the error since I
didn't wrote it up when I tried, but I recall it was something about
ambiguity (I mean the change of int with long int, the undef method
worked fine)
(Gentoo amd64 + gcc4.1.1)
